The long term destruction linked to an unchecked infestation goes far beyond shallow aesthetic damage or minor domestic irritation. These animals have specialized front teeth that grow continuously throughout their lives, compelling them to gnaw on dense materials to keep their incisors down to a workable size. This consistent chewing routinely ruins structural timber joists, plasterboard walls, and costly ceiling insulation layers. Even more concerning is their tendency to strip the protective insulation away from internal electrical wiring, developing an instant fire risk that threatens the whole structure. From a hygienic point of view, these animals are understood vectors for numerous transmissible health problems, spreading damaging pathogens across kitchen area benches and cooking zones by means of their fur, urine, and faeces. Removing a well developed infestation needs a strategic structure rather than short-term reactive options. Standard retail breeze traps and standard off the shelf baits normally just handle to capture separated foragers while leaving the main breeding nest entirely untouched inside the property framework. Expert pest management focuses on performing a careful forensic evaluation of the whole building outside to discover exactly where the pests are breaching the perimeter. A small mouse can compress its body to slide through a space measuring less than the width of a standard pen, indicating that open weep holes, loose pipe penetrations, and misaligned roof tiles are major vulnerabilities. Installing sturdy wire mesh, metal barriers, and specialized sealing compounds guarantees that when the interior area is completely cleared, future entry is completely obstructed.
Implementing clever ecological practices around the garden also plays an indispensable role in stopping these relentless foragers from residing near home limits. Denying access to possible food products by fitting secure lids to yard compost pile, keeping chicken feed in strong plastic drums, and removing pet food bowls directly after dinner will make the allotment far less luring. Moreover, weakening thick garden beds, trimming low hanging tree branches that form a bridge to the rain gutters, and clearing away stockpiles of unused structure products gets rid of the protective ground cover that these animals rely on to conceal before making their last face property roofs. Constant backyard cleanliness functions as an important frontline defence, making the overall border highly inhospitable to foraging wildlife.
